What is Bespoke Extracts Interest Expense?

Bespoke Extracts BSPK 10 Interest Expense is $-0.11 Mil as of Sep. 2025. GuruFocus rates BSPK with a GF Score™ of 10/100 and a GF Value™ of $0.21 (Possible Value Trap). The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review.

Interest Expense is the amount reported by a company or individual as an expense for borrowed money. Bespoke Extracts's interest expense for the three months ended in Sep. 2025 was $ -0.02 Mil. Its interest expense for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2025 was $-0.11 Mil.

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income(EBIT) by its Interest Expense. Bespoke Extracts's Operating Income for the three months ended in Sep. 2025 was $ -0.05 Mil. Bespoke Extracts's Interest Expense for the three months ended in Sep. 2025 was $ -0.02 Mil. Bespoke Extracts did not have earnings to cover the interest expense. The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is. Bespoke Extracts Business Description

Address 12001 East 33rd Avenue, Unit O, Aurora, Denver, CO, USA, 80010
Bespoke Extracts Inc is focused on selling its proprietary line of specially-formulated, quality, hemp-derived CBD products. The company owns, manufactures, and distributes a portfolio of cannabis consumer packaged goods brands including Fresh Joints, Doobskis, DutchBlunts, and Wee Joints, to licensed marijuana dispensaries across Colorado.
